Quandl - Financial Data API features and specs

  • Comprehensive Data Coverage
    Quandl's Financial Data API offers a wide range of financial and economic datasets, including stock prices, commodities, futures, currencies, and macroeconomic indicators. This makes it versatile for various research and analysis needs.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    The API is designed to be developer-friendly with clear documentation and easy-to-use endpoints, enabling users to quickly integrate and start accessing data.
  • Wide Range of Data Sources
    Quandl aggregates data from numerous sources, including Nasdaq, central banks, and economic institutions, providing users access to information that might otherwise require multiple subscriptions.
  • Data Customization
    Users can access data in various formats (XML, JSON, CSV) and utilize it within different programming environments, enhancing data processing and integration flexibility.
  • Regular Data Updates
    Quandl ensures that the data is consistently updated, offering real-time or near-real-time data for more accurate and timely analysis.

Possible disadvantages of Quandl - Financial Data API

  • Cost
    Accessing Quandl's premium datasets can be expensive, which might be a limitation for individual users or small businesses with tight budgets.
  • Dataset Availability
    While Quandl offers a wide range of data, some highly specialized or niche datasets might not be available, potentially limiting its usefulness for specialized research.
  • Data Limitations for Free API
    The free API tier offers limited access to data, meaning users may need a subscription for comprehensive data access and advanced features.
  • Integration Challenges
    Despite a user-friendly API, integrating data from different sources and updating scripts for dataset changes can be complex and time-consuming.
  • Dependency on Data Providers
    Quandl's accuracy and availability are dependent on its data providers. Any delay or error in data provision from these providers can impact the overall reliability of Quandl's API.

React Engine features and specs

  • Isomorphic rendering
    React Engine enables both server-side and client-side rendering of React components, providing a seamless isomorphic/universal JavaScript experience. This allows for faster initial page loads and better SEO while maintaining rich client-side interactivity.
  • Express.js integration
    React Engine is designed as a view engine for Express.js, making it easy to integrate React into existing Express-based applications with minimal configuration. It follows familiar Express conventions for setting up view engines.
  • Built-in React Router support
    The library comes with built-in support for React Router, enabling developers to easily set up server-side and client-side routing without complex manual configuration.
  • PayPal backing
    React Engine was developed and maintained by PayPal, which provided credibility and ensured it was battle-tested in a large-scale production environment before being open-sourced.
  • Simplified setup
    The library abstracts away much of the complexity involved in setting up server-side rendering with React, reducing boilerplate code and allowing developers to get a universal React application running quickly.

Possible disadvantages of React Engine

  • Abandoned project
    The repository appears to be no longer actively maintained, with no recent commits or updates. This makes it risky to use in production as bugs and security vulnerabilities may go unpatched.
  • Outdated dependencies
    React Engine was built for older versions of React and React Router. It may not be compatible with modern versions of React (16+, 17, 18) or React Router (v5, v6), limiting its usefulness in current projects.
  • Limited ecosystem support
    The library is tightly coupled to Express.js, meaning it cannot be easily used with other Node.js frameworks like Koa, Hapi, or Fastify, reducing its flexibility.
  • Better modern alternatives
    Modern tools like Next.js, Remix, and Vite with SSR plugins provide far more comprehensive and well-maintained solutions for server-side rendering with React, making React Engine largely obsolete.
  • Limited documentation and community
    The project has relatively sparse documentation and a small community, making it difficult for new developers to troubleshoot issues or find examples and best practices for advanced use cases.
